.comm-banner{background:linear-gradient(180deg,#fbfbfb,#d1e6fa);padding:80px 0;position:relative;z-index:1}.comm-banner:after{background-image:url(https://47032319.fs1.hubspotusercontent-na1.net/hubfs/47032319/community/banner-filler.png);background-position:50%;background-repeat:no-repeat;background-size:cover;content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:-1}.comm-banner .heading-txt{margin:0 auto 60px;text-align:center}.comm-banner .heading-txt h1{font-size:85px}.comm-banner .heading-txt p{font-family:Noto Sans,sans-serif;font-size:32px;font-weight:600;margin:0 auto}.comm-banner .cta-class{margin-top:50px;text-align:center}.comm-banner .cta-class a{background-color:#266adc;box-shadow:0 10px 20px rgba(65,58,164,.2);box-sizing:border-box!important;color:#fff;cursor:pointer;display:inline-block;font-family:Noto Sans,sans-serif;font-size:20px;font-weight:600;padding:14px 38px;transition:.3s ease}.cta-class a:hover{background-color:#205fc8!important}.comm-banner .parent{background-position:50%;background-repeat:no-repeat;background-size:cover;height:237px;margin-left:-15px;margin-right:-15px;width:100%}.comm-banner .banner-img{position:relative}.comm-banner .banner-img .filler-images{position:absolute}.comm-banner .banner-img .filler-images.filler-images-1{left:18%;top:95px}.comm-banner .banner-img .filler-images.filler-images-2{left:32%;top:3%}.comm-banner .banner-img .filler-images.filler-images-3{bottom:7px;left:36%}.comm-banner .banner-img .filler-images.filler-images-4{left:42%;top:28%}.comm-banner .banner-img .filler-images.filler-images-5{right:46%;top:16px}.comm-banner .banner-img .filler-images.filler-images-6{bottom:80px;right:47%}.comm-banner .banner-img .filler-images.filler-images-7{right:38%;top:70px}.comm-banner .banner-img .filler-images.filler-images-8{right:24%;top:40px}.popup-form.show{display:block}.popup-form{background-color:rgba(0,0,0,.39);cursor:pointer;display:none;height:100%;position:fixed;scroll-margin-top:60px;z-index:999}.popup-form,.popup-form .popup-container{left:50%;overflow-y:auto;top:50%;transform:translate(-50%,-50%);width:100%}.popup-form .popup-container{background-color:#fff;border-radius:25px;cursor:auto;height:650px;margin:auto;max-width:568px;padding:42px 35px;position:absolute;text-align:center}.popup-form .popup-container .logo-block{margin-bottom:12px}.popup-form .popup-container h5{font-size:36px;font-weight:600;margin-bottom:22px}.popup-form .popup-container .hs-form-field{margin-bottom:20px;position:relative}.popup-form .hs_0-2\/recruiters_community .input{position:relative}.popup-form .hs_0-2\/recruiters_community .input:after{background:#00000000;border-right:1px solid #000;border-top:1px solid #000;content:"";height:8px;position:absolute;right:20px;rotate:135deg;top:16px;width:8px}.popup-form .popup-container form .inputs-list>li{margin:0}.popup-form .popup-container form .inputs-list{bottom:-20px;margin:0;padding:0;position:absolute}.popup-form .popup-container form .hs-error-msg{font-size:12px;margin:0}.popup-form .popup-container form input[type=submit]{display:block;font-size:16px;padding:14px;position:relative;width:100%}.popup-form .popup-container form input[type=submit]:focus,.popup-form .popup-container form input[type=submit]:hover{background-color:#205fc8!important}.popup-form .popup-container form input,.popup-form .popup-container form select{border:1px solid #266adc}.popup-form .popup-container form input::-webkit-input-placeholder,.popup-form .popup-container form input::placeholder{color:#000}.popup-form .popup-container form select{appearance:none;color:#000}.popup-form .hs_error_rollup{position:relative}.popup-form .hs_error_rollup .hs-main-font-element{bottom:-65px;left:0;position:absolute;text-align:left;width:500px}.popup-form span.cross{background-color:#fff;border-radius:50%;cursor:pointer;font-size:19px;font-weight:800;padding:4px 11px;position:absolute;right:10px;top:30px}.comm-banner form .hs_company.hs-company{display:none}.comm-banner form.job-seeker-selected .hs_company.hs-company{display:block}@media(max-width:1024px){.comm-banner{padding:60px 0}.comm-banner:after{display:none}.comm-banner .heading-txt{max-width:800px}.banner-img .parent{height:272px}.comm-banner .banner-img .filler-images.filler-images-1{left:0;top:70px}.comm-banner .banner-img .filler-images.filler-images-2{left:20%}.comm-banner .banner-img .filler-images.filler-images-3{left:29%}.comm-banner .banner-img .filler-images.filler-images-4{left:41%;top:26%}.comm-banner .banner-img .filler-images.filler-images-5{right:40%;top:13px}.comm-banner .banner-img .filler-images.filler-images-6{bottom:66px;right:38%}.comm-banner .banner-img .filler-images.filler-images-7{right:25%;top:52px}.comm-banner .banner-img .filler-images.filler-images-8{right:0;top:40px}}@media(max-width:767px){.comm-banner{padding:40px 0}.comm-banner .heading-txt{margin:0 auto 40px;max-width:460px}.comm-banner .heading-txt h1{font-size:48px}.comm-banner .heading-txt p{font-size:24px}.banner-img .parent{height:188px}.comm-banner .banner-img .filler-images.filler-images-1{width:48px}.comm-banner .banner-img .filler-images.filler-images-2{left:14%;top:20px;width:35px}.comm-banner .banner-img .filler-images.filler-images-4{left:30%;top:40%;width:29px}.comm-banner .banner-img .filler-images.filler-images-3{left:37%;top:125px;width:40px}.comm-banner .banner-img .filler-images.filler-images-5{right:50%;top:26px;width:29px}.comm-banner .banner-img .filler-images.filler-images-8{top:70px;width:41px}.comm-banner .banner-img .filler-images.filler-images-7{right:20%;top:36px;width:35px}.comm-banner .banner-img .filler-images.filler-images-6{bottom:66px;right:32%;width:30px}.cta-class a{max-width:342px;width:100%}.popup-form .popup-container{height:400px;max-width:458px;padding:20px}.popup-form .popup-container h5{font-size:24px}.popup-form .hs_error_rollup .hs-main-font-element{width:270px}.popup-form .popup-container form input[type=submit]{padding:11px}}